ON Semiconductor STK55xU3xxx-E integrated power modules

Saturday, 19 July, 2014 | Supplied by: Future Electronics


ON Semiconductor has expanded its high-voltage IPM portfolio with the STK55xU3xxx-E family. With a power range of 10 to 50 A in SIP and DIP packaging, the IPMs integrate a complete three-phase inverter including the gate drive circuit. The company’s latest IGBT and driver technologies are incorporated into the IPMs, minimising switching losses of the module.

The modules are based on the Insulated Metal Substrate Technology (IMST), which is said to exhibit many benefits over existing standard frame types, including good thermal coupling and response, low power losses, fast temperature monitoring and reduced switching surges. IMST enables assembly of discrete passive components (resistors, capacitors), discrete active components (diodes, transistors) and more complex devices (gate drivers, DSPs logic) into high integrated modules.
